I’ve been around the block when it comes to SEO. Spent more money than I’d like to admit on agencies and so-called experts for companies and startups I’ve worked with. I’ve also been on the other side of the fence, working at big digital marketing agencies and rolling up my sleeves as an SEO consultant.
I mention this because I’ve seen it all—the good, the bad, and the downright ugly. So, if you’re scratching your head wondering, “Should I hire an SEO agency?” trust me, I’ve been there.
Over the past decade, I’ve probably wasted a small fortune trying to figure this out. Let me save you some time (and cash) by breaking down what you need to know about hiring an SEO agency.
BTW… If you’re contemplating between hiring an SEO expert OR an SEO agency, I broke down the pros and cons in this article.
Why Hire an SEO Company?
First off, let’s talk about why you’d even consider bringing an SEO agency on board. If you’re looking for a list of vetted SEO agencies, here you go!
Professionalism
When you hire an SEO company, you’re paying for professionalism. These folks have teams of specialists—technical SEO gurus, content wizards, link-building experts—you name it. They’ve got processes and systems in place to get the job done efficiently.
It’s like hiring the guy in a nice suit over the one with shorts on doing SEO in his basement. Not saying one’s better than the other, but one is certainly more visually appealing.
The Job Will Get Done
Agencies have dedicated resources. Your project won’t fall through the cracks because someone got too busy or decided to take a month-long vacation. They’ve got the manpower to keep things moving.
Peace of Mind
There’s something comforting about handing over your SEO to a team and knowing they’ll handle it. it goes back to the professionalism bit. One less thing for you to stress about. You can focus on running your business while they work on boosting your online presence.
Drawbacks of Hiring an SEO Company or Agency
But let’s not pretend it’s all smooth sailing. There are some downsides you need to be aware of.
Lack of Personal Touch
With agencies, you might feel like just another cog in the machine. You’re not getting that one-on-one attention you’d get with an SEO consultant. Sometimes you end up talking to a different person every time you reach out. It can feel impersonal.
High Cost
Let’s face it—agencies aren’t cheap. Compared to freelancers, they tend to charge higher rates, on average. They’ve got overhead costs like office space, salaries for their team, fancy coffee machines—the works. Those costs get passed on to you. If you’re a small business or startup, this might stretch your budget thin.
Too Many Cooks in the Kitchen
Here’s something that drove me nuts when I hired agencies in the past. I’d get emails from person A, then person B, then someone else entirely. The person who sealed the deal was often nowhere to be found once the project started. Communication became a game of telephone, and important details slipped through the cracks. Frustrating doesn’t even begin to cover it.
You Have No Recourse
Their contracts are usually bulletproof. If they don’t deliver results, you’re kind of stuck. Sure, you might be able to terminate the contract, but getting a refund? Good luck with that. You’re left holding the bag.
How to Hire an SEO Marketing Company
Ask the Right Questions: Don’t just sign on the dotted line with the first agency that comes along. Do your homework.
Who Have They Worked With?
Ask about their past clients. Have they worked with companies in your industry? Do they have experience with businesses of your size? If they mostly handle big corporations and you’re a small startup, that might not be the best fit.
What Do They Actually Do?
Get into the nitty-gritty. What tactics do they use? Are they focused on content creation, backlinks, technical SEO? Make sure their approach aligns with your goals.
What Can You Guarantee?
Sometimes it’s trying to pry a banana out of a gorilla’s hands. But also be wary of agencies that promise you the moon. No one can guarantee specific rankings or results in SEO—there are too many variables at play. But they should be able to provide realistic expectations and key performance indicators (KPIs).
Is SEO the Only Thing They Do?
Some agencies offer everything under the sun—web design, PPC ads, social media management, you name it. While that might sound appealing, sometimes it’s better to go with a company that specializes in SEO if that’s your main focus.
How to Hire the Right SEO Company
Here’s my two cents.
If your sole focus is SEO, go with an agency that lives and breathes it. You want specialists who eat, sleep, and breathe SEO, who stay up-to-date with the latest algorithm changes and best practices.
If you need a broader range of services—like pay-per-click ads, social media management, or web design—then a full-service digital marketing agency might be the way to go.
But remember, whether you’re hiring an SEO agency, a consultant, or thinking about doing it yourself, there’s no magic wand. SEO takes time, effort, and a fair amount of patience.
Wrapping It Up
At the end of the day, the decision comes down to your specific needs, budget, and how hands-on you want to be. Agencies can offer professionalism and peace of mind, but they come with drawbacks like higher costs and less personal attention.
Do your homework, ask the tough questions, and trust your gut. The right agency can propel your business forward, but the wrong one can set you back both financially and in search rankings.
Good luck out there!